Study the collections at Buddha Tooth Relic Temple and Museum, Chinatown Heritage Center, or Asian Civilisations Museum. Old Hill Street Police Station, Former City Hall, and Stamford House are well-known local landmarks worth a visit. You can check out the local talent at Esplanade Theatres, Victoria Theatre and Concert Hall, and Capitol Theatre.
How can I get to Al-Abrar Mosque?
With so many transportation options, seeing the area around Al-Abrar Mosque is simple. Walk to nearby metro stations like Clarke Quay Station, Chinatown Station, and Fort Canning MRT station. You can explore water transportation options at the local marina.
